Historic legislation would reduce gas prices by finding more energy while using less
WASHINGTON - Republican S.D. Sen. John Thune today joined 43 of his Senate colleagues by introducing major energy legislation aimed at reducing the price of gas by tapping oil and oil shale reserves here in the United States, increasing research and development for electric cars and trucks, and strengthening the U. S. futures markets.
"The rising price of oil and gas is costing the American people too much. Congress must put politics aside and address this growing problem. It is time for Congress to put policies in place that can have an impact on these out of control fuel prices," Thune said.
"America has 14 billion barrels of oil off our coasts and hundreds of billions more in western states that can and should be safely explored and brought to market," he added. "By increasing supply and lowering consumption, America can regain energy independence."
